Output d12a03245643c56590cff46ff0fbb4d4d2b4d4045545b4190aa9b75601dceea2:0

value
63992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d51fcfab06818d6a13fe5e9c97a07b824e0cb75 OP_EQUAL
address
3EaFREQEpGK1b2v5XFEHk3DSu1qTPPC1ry
transaction
d12a03245643c56590cff46ff0fbb4d4d2b4d4045545b4190aa9b75601dceea2
confirmations
195373
spent
true